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

gprevidi

google com tabelas

Recommended Posts

Aee,por curiosidade fui olhar o código fonte da interface do google.com.br... e me deparei com um tabelas?não sei se alguém já comentou isso no fórum... dêem uma olhada

<html><head><meta http-equiv="content-type" content="text/html; charset=UTF-8"><title>Google</title><style><!--body,td,a,p,.h{font-family:arial,sans-serif}.h{font-size:20px}.h{color:#3366cc}.q{color:#00c}.ts td{padding:0}.ts{border-collapse:collapse}--></style><script><!--window.google={kEI:"ijiVRrzVK4PowQLA4oF-",kEXPI:"0",kHL:"pt-BR"};function sf(){document.f.q.focus();}// --></script></head><body bgcolor=#ffffff text=#000000 link=#0000cc vlink=#551a8b alink=#ff0000 onload="sf();if(document.images){new Image().src='/images/nav_logo3.png'}" topmargin=3 marginheight=3><div align=right id=guser style="font-size:84%;padding:0 0 4px" width=100%><nobr><a href="/url?sa=p&pref=ig&pval=3&q=http://www.google.com.br/ig%3Fhl%3Dpt-BR&usg=AFQjCNHC9sjtTsnNV2oJcI0mkhvkNs0Exw">iGoogle</a> | <a href="https://www.google.com/accounts/Login?continue=http://www.google.com.br/&hl=pt-BR">Efetuar login</a></nobr></div><center><br id=lgpd><img alt="Google" height=110 src="/intl/pt-BR_br/images/logo.gif" width=276><br><br><form action="/search" name=f><style>#lgpd{display:none}</style><script defer><!--function qs(el){if(window.RegExp&&window.encodeURIComponent){var ue=el.href,qe=encodeURIComponent(document.f.q.value);if(ue.indexOf("q=")!=-1){el.href=ue.replace(new RegExp("q=[^&$]*"),"q="+qe);}else{el.href=ue+"&q="+qe;}}return 1;}//--></script><table border=0 cellspacing=0 cellpadding=4><tr><td nowrap><font size=-1><b>Web</b>    <a class=q href="http://images.google.com.br/imghp?ie=UTF-8&oe=UTF-8&hl=pt-BR&tab=wi" onclick="return qs(this)">Imagens</a>    <a class=q href="http://groups.google.com.br/grphp?ie=UTF-8&oe=UTF-8&hl=pt-BR&tab=wg" onclick="return qs(this)">Grupos</a>    <a class=q href="http://news.google.com.br/nwshp?ie=UTF-8&oe=UTF-8&hl=pt-BR&tab=wn" onclick="return qs(this)">Notícias</a>    <b><a href="/intl/pt-BR/options/" class=q>mais »</a></b></font></td></tr></table><table cellpadding=0 cellspacing=0><tr valign=top><td width=25%> </td><td align=center nowrap><input name=hl type=hidden value=pt-BR><input maxlength=2048 name=q size=55 title="Pesquisa Google" value=""><br><input name=btnG type=submit value="Pesquisa Google"><input name=btnI type=submit value="Estou com sorte"></td><td nowrap width=25%><font size=-2>  <a href=/advanced_search?hl=pt-BR>Pesquisa avançada</a><br>  <a href=/preferences?hl=pt-BR>Preferências</a><br>  <a href=/language_tools?hl=pt-BR>Ferramentas de idiomas</a></font></td></tr><tr><td align=center colspan=3><font size=-1>Pesquisar: <input id=all type=radio name=meta value="" checked><label for=all> a web </label><input id=lgr type=radio name=meta value="lr=lang_pt"><label for=lgr> páginas em português </label><input id=cty type=radio name=meta value="cr=countryBR"><label for=cty> páginas do Brasil </label></font></td></tr></table></form><br><br><font size=-1><a href="/intl/pt-BR/ads/">Soluções de publicidade</a> - <a href="/intl/pt-BR/about.html">Tudo sobre o Google</a> - <a href=http://www.google.com/ncr>Google.com in English</a></font><p><font size=-2>©2007 Google</font></p></center></body></html>

Compartilhar este post


Link para o post
Compartilhar em outros sites

O Google é muito misterioso para ser comentado, e creio que existam diversas "equipes" que trabalham em aplicações diferentes, portanto talvez algumas sejam com e outras sem tabelas, porém nenhuma tem o código perfeitamente nos padrões...É realmente difícil desenvolver grandes aplicações/sites totalmente nos padrões, como podemos notar em diversos casos conhecidos, porém nem sempre precisa-se apelar para as tabelas[]'s

Compartilhar este post


Link para o post
Compartilhar em outros sites

Concordo com o #INSIDE#... projetos grandes têm código que parece uma salada russa... mas... é o carro chefe da Google né???Se eles tentassem não usar as tables poderiam ter código mais leve...Mas por outro lado não funcionaria corretamente em alguns navegadoresSei lá :) acho que eles sabem disso.

Compartilhar este post


Link para o post
Compartilhar em outros sites

E outra coisa: quem disse que Google é sinônimo de padrão? Ele é o maior site de busca no mundo, isso sem dúvida, mas não deve ser confundido com o W3C ou qualquer coisa parecida... Cada um é cada um, né? Se o Google fosse "padronizado", os resultados de busca de imagens por exemplo não seriam exibidos em páginas que utilizam frames... <_<

Compartilhar este post


Link para o post
Compartilhar em outros sites

E outra coisa: quem disse que Google é sinônimo de padrão? Ele é o maior site de busca no mundo, isso sem dúvida, mas não deve ser confundido com o W3C ou qualquer coisa parecida... Cada um é cada um, né? Se o Google fosse "padronizado", os resultados de busca de imagens por exemplo não seriam exibidos em páginas que utilizam frames... <_<

concordo com o amigo Paulo, Google não é sinônimo de padrão ^^ http://forum.imasters.com.br/public/style_emoticons/default/assobiando.gif

Compartilhar este post


Link para o post
Compartilhar em outros sites

Isso só destaca que não precisa seguir padrões W3C para ser grande, o importante é atender a necessidade do cliente.De qq forma a politica do Google é: "Menos é mais."

Compartilhar este post


Link para o post
Compartilhar em outros sites

Lembrando bem, o orkut e outros sites da google usam ASPaffffffffffffsem comentários http://forum.imasters.com.br/public/style_emoticons/default/devil.gif

Bom, quanto ao seu comentário.....o tópico é sobre webstandards, não programação. Eu trabalho com asp e garanto que tem inumeras vantagens, assim como desvantagens em relação a outras linguagens. Cada aplicação requer uma linguagem e conhecimento necessário. imagina se um site de portifolio fosse feito com JSP? Não há necessidade. De repente pro google o Asp tá mais que suficiente a ponto de não arriscar a troca.Bom, minha opinião sobre as tabelas do google, concordo com o inside em partes....desenvolver uma grande aplicação dentro dos padrões é complicado, mas quem faz uma grande aplicação é uma grande empresa(imagina-se), então ela teria que pensar nisso também, mesmo porque o google hoje é o maior buscador da web e se o código fosse nos padrões seria melhor do que já é. Porém, o Ricardo Lima observou bem quando disse que não funcionaria em alguns navegadores e isso iria envolver profissionais e verba para constantemente acertar o código para ser executado na maioria dos browsers. Acho que ai tá o ponto, problema não é o google e sim os browsers que sempre são incompativeis

Compartilhar este post


Link para o post
Compartilhar em outros sites

O Google usa python também, não podemos deixar de mencionar... xDÉ, pra entender o google soh o google mesmo[]'s

Compartilhar este post


Link para o post
Compartilhar em outros sites

quando vi o topico confesso que fiquei surpreso, mais assim como já citaram outros grandes portais também fazem usos de tabelas e não seguem 100% nos padrões.... mais concordo com o "jonathandj"

problema não é o google e sim os browsers que sempre são incompativeis

porque, se desenvolver sites menores já é trabalho preucupar-se com imcompatibilidades, imaginem grandes portais...até mais...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Os Padrões estão deixando cada vez mais as pessoas confusas. :blink: O certo é segui-los... mas acho que nem sempre é possível... ;) E como falaram, não é porque os sites são grandes que estão ou devem estar 100% nos padrões... Colocar as bordinhas arredondadas como tem no Gmail e Orkut agora, com o CSS (-moz-border-radius) a W3C não aceita... pois alguns navegadores não reconhecem... Neste caso, não vejo como fazer isso de outra maneira a não ser tabelas... Ou será que com "divs" teria como fazer?Estou iniciando na área Web e ainda fico meio confusa com tudo isso... evito ao máximo tabelas em meus trabalhos... mas ao mesmo tempo, em meu curso os sites são projetados somente com tabelas :(

Compartilhar este post


Link para o post
Compartilhar em outros sites

em meu curso os sites são projetados somente com tabelas

Infelizmente os cursos que temos hoje em dia são umas porcariasMas agora, pra fazer simples cantos arredondados não precisa usar tabelas não, é muito fácil, e tem tutoriais sobre isso por aí...[]'s

Compartilhar este post


Link para o post
Compartilhar em outros sites

Fala galera querida!

 

bom, só para fazer alguns esclarecimentos..

inicialmente, o orkut tinha sido feito em ASP.NET (aspx).. e há um certo tempo, ele foi inteiramente migrado para JAVA (JSP).. só que eles mantiveram as extensões das páginas, para não dar rebuliço, nem nada.. Motivos: pelo java ser mais robusto e seguro; pelo Google ser um concorrente Microsoft a curto e longo prazo.

 

Quanto às tabelas no Orkut, apesaaaar das tabelas 'para bordas arredondadas', o número de tabelas foi reduzido drasticamente! pra cada scrap, tinham umas duas tabelas.. agora SÓ EXISTE TABELA por causa das bordas. Eu acho isso um grande progresso.

 

e sobre as (muitas) linguagens do Google, eles usam Python, PHP, JSP.. e por aí vai! :lol:

depende mais da 'Fé' dos gerentes de TI do que da eterna competição, de 'qual linguagem é melhor'

 

Bom, é isso ae!

cheguei no tópico, pois estou escrevendo em meu Blog sobre como o Google otimiza sua página de busca.. apesar de ele não seguir os padrões, existem alguns detalhes interessantes, e que devem ser levados em conta http://forum.imasters.com.br/public/style_emoticons/default/grin.gif

 

Valeu galera!

Compartilhar este post


Link para o post
Compartilhar em outros sites

em meu curso os sites são projetados somente com tabelasInfelizmente os cursos que temos hoje em dia são umas porcariasMas agora, pra fazer simples cantos arredondados não precisa usar tabelas não, é muito fácil, e tem tutoriais sobre isso por aí...

no meu curso tb, infelizmenteao decorrer do curso fui lendo e pesquisando sobre a montagem de sites, xhtml, css, webstandards..ai fui vendo que o curso esta caro d+ pro conteudo apresentado...um porcaria mesmoe sobre os cantos arrendondados, eu comprei o livro 'dominando tabless' e gostei bastante do livro, aprendi muito mesmoembora seja um livro para iniciantes...no final do livro o Marcus VBP desenvolve um site e faz uns cantos arredondados no layout, totalmente tableless

Compartilhar este post


Link para o post
Compartilhar em outros sites

Vamos reunir o pessoal e criar uma rede de ensino web 2.0 =] :P[]'s

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.